Reasons for Declining Deal Activity
Experts associate the decline in M&A with a set of fundamental factors. Firstly, the tightening of regulatory barriers has significantly complicated the exit of non-residents from Russian business: the regulations introduced at the end of 2024 entail hefty fines and additional payments to the budget, totaling up to 95% of the asset value, effectively blocking most transactions involving foreign capital.
